The Allure of the Zucca Print:
The Zucca print, a distinctive monogram featuring a stylized "Fendi" logo interwoven with a repeating pattern of dark brown and beige on a canvas base, is synonymous with Fendi's heritage. Introduced in the late 1990s, it quickly became a symbol of the brand's playful yet sophisticated approach to luxury. Unlike many other designer prints, the Zucca print transcends fleeting trends. Its classic appeal allows it to effortlessly transition through the decades, maintaining its relevance and desirability. This enduring quality is a significant factor contributing to the high demand for vintage Fendi zucca bags, including the coveted box bag style.
The Box Bag's Distinctive Design:
The Fendi Zucca print box bag, a highly sought-after piece, stands out due to its structured, boxy silhouette. This rigid shape provides a unique aesthetic, differentiating it from other Fendi Zucca styles like the more relaxed tote bags or the versatile crossbody bags. The box shape offers a practical element, maintaining its shape even when not fully loaded, and providing a defined and elegant structure that complements various outfits.
Typically crafted from high-quality canvas with leather trim, the box bag showcases meticulous attention to detail. The leather handles, often in a complementary color like brown or black, are robust and comfortable, designed for both hand-carrying and over-the-shoulder use. The hardware, usually featuring the Fendi logo, is typically gold-toned, adding a touch of opulence to the overall design. The interior lining is often a contrasting fabric, adding another layer of sophistication. The structured design and high-quality materials contribute to the bag's durability, ensuring it can withstand the test of time, a key factor in its appeal as a vintage investment.
Authenticating Your Fendi Zucca Box Bag:
Given the high demand for authentic Fendi Zucca bags, including the box bag style, it's crucial to know how to authenticate your purchase. Buying a counterfeit bag can be a disappointing and expensive mistake. Therefore, careful scrutiny is essential. Here are some key steps to help you authenticate a Fendi Zucca bag:
* Examine the Zucca Print: The print itself should be crisp, clear, and consistent. Blurry or misaligned prints are a strong indicator of a counterfeit. The colors should be rich and vibrant, not faded or dull.
* Inspect the Stitching: Fendi bags are known for their meticulous stitching. Examine the seams carefully. The stitching should be even, straight, and tightly done. Loose threads or uneven stitching are red flags.
